What is the first scenario for calculating confidence interval?

A

Known pop sd

30
Q

What are the elements of the first scenario for calculating confidence interval?

A

Use z and normal distribution to get critical value, use o to get standard error

31
Q

What is the second scenario for calculating confidence interval?

A

Large sample and unknown pop sd

32
Q

What are the elements of the second scenario of calculating confidence interval?

A

Use z and normal distribution to get critical value, use s to estimate o for standard error

33
Q

What is the third scenario for calculating confidence interval?

A

Small sample and unknown pop sd

34
Q

What are the elements for the third scenario of calculating confidence interval?

A

Use t and t-distribution to determine critical value, use s to estimate o for standard error
